6倍性能差?POLARDB重新定义数据库标准!

2017云栖大会•北京峰会阿里云高级产品专家贺军做了题为POLARDB性能揭秘的分享。POLARDB是阿里云数据库团队研发的全新一代商用关系型数据库,贺军在POLARDB产品架构,产品特性,性能方面做了详细介绍,产品创新方面亮出了“兵器谱”,一起了解下吧~

# polardb6倍超高性能的奥秘
如今随着用户流量大,业务量增加导致的数据的增长,对数据库的性能要求也越来越大,阿里云自主研发的POLARDB解决了传统数据库暴露的问题,与传统数据库不同,技术方面,POLARDB采用了一写多读的架构设计,安全扩展性则采用了多副本分布式存储,

**#
POLARD产品有哪些特性**
产品设计决定了它的性能,实现6倍于MySQL性能的提升,在兼容性方面更是百分百兼容MySQL,解决传统数据库高峰访问量的数据库瓶颈问题,并且实现最大100T超大的存储容量,此外,polardb同样支持弹性计算按需存储容量扩展,高可用高可靠等服务

**#
对比传统数据库POLARDB云数据库的创新**

RDMA是一种远端内存直接访问技术,相当于传统的socket协议软硬件架构相比较,高速,超低延时,极低的CPU使用率的RDMA主导了RDMA的高速发展。分布式技术将负载由单个节点转移到多个,保证高并发业务量情况下正常运行,具体如上图所示。在主库和从库间之间的数据传输流,放弃了原有的binlog同步方式,而是用innodb的redolog实现了物理复制,大大的提升了数据的正确性和性能的提升。阿里云POLARDB数据库秉持着开源数据库生态,追寻自由开放的软件精神,不断的将技术分享回馈给自由的世界。

综合以上来看,POLARD不管从RDMA远程访问技术,分布式共享存储,redlog物理复制,一写多读的副本模型对当今数据库的趋势发展都是一个质的提升, 也是对传统数据库的革命性进化

时间: 2024-08-23 22:07:44

6倍性能差?POLARDB重新定义数据库标准!的相关文章

6倍性能差100TB容量,阿里云POLARDB咋实现?

本文讲的是6倍性能差100TB容量,阿里云POLARDB咋实现?[IT168 云计算]POLARDB是阿里云数据库团队研发的基于第三代云计算架构下的商用关系型云数据库产品,实现100%向下兼容MySQL 5.6的同时,支持单库容量扩展至上百TB以及计算引擎能力及存储能力的秒级扩展能力,对比MySQL有6倍性能提升及相对于商业数据库实现大幅度降低成本. 第三代分布式共享存储架构究竟有什么优势? ▲POLARDB的第三代分布式共享存储架构 首先,受益于第三代分布式共享存储架构,使POLARDB实现了

阿里云POLARDB发布:6倍性能差,100TB容量

阿里云的数据库产品团队已经有了七年的历史.从2011年开始,阿里云每年都会发布两至三个重量级的产品,以及一至两个重要的功能更新.在连续五年时间的里,每一年都有超过一千项以上的功能优化,在2015年发布了1100项功能的优化,而在2016年这个数字是1800项.今年这个数字应该会突破3000项.阿里云的数据库产品包括主流的关系型.NoSQL非关系型数据库.面向大数据和AI的混合分析数据库.面向搜索和物联网等场景的搜索和时序数据库.为了方便用户将数据库上云,阿里云还有配套的迁移管理服务和工具. 阿里

6倍性能差100TB容量,阿里云POLARDB如何实现?

一. POLARDB产品架构简介 POLARDB是阿里云数据库团队研发的基于第三代云计算架构下的商用关系型云数据库产品,实现100%向下兼容MySQL 5.6的同时,支持单库容量扩展至上百TB以及计算引擎能力及存储能力的秒级扩展能力,对比MySQL有6倍性能提升及相对于商业数据库实现大幅度降低成本. 第三代分布式共享存储架构究竟有什么优势? 图为POLARDB的第三代分布式共享存储架构 首先,受益于第三代分布式共享存储架构,使POLARDB实现了计算节点(主要做SQL解析以及存储引擎计算的服务器

这下没理由嫌Eval的性能差了吧?

好吧,你偏要说Eval性能差 写ASP.NET中使用Eval是再常见不过的手段了,好像任何一本ASP.NET书里都会描述如何把一个DataTable绑定到一个控件里去,并且通过Eval来取值的用法.不过在目前的DDD(Domain Driven Design)时代,我们操作的所操作的经常是领域模型对象.我们可以把任何一个实现了IEnumerable的对象作为绑定控件的数据源,并且在绑定控件中通过Eval来获取字段的值.如下: protected void Page_Load(object sen

oracle中怎么确定性能差的SQL语句

前者很容易定位.所有的操作系统都可以让我们查看 CPU 密集型任务.这些任务可以追溯到一个特定用户,一个特定应用程序模块. CPU 密集型模块一般都是由较差的代码和/或结构造成,而不是性能差的 SQL.一旦确定模块,你必须试图使之更有效率.一个可能的解决方案是将把某些处理移除程序,让数据库处理(高明点的 SQL,存储对象,内联函数,数组处理等). 第二个是 I/O 密集型的 SQL 语句.这些语句会导致大量的数据库 I/O(全表扫描,排序,更新等),并以很高代价运行几个小时.从 Oracle 7

《DBA修炼之道:数据库管理员的第一本书》——2.4节数据库标准与过程

2.4 数据库标准与过程想要有效地使用新安装的DBMS,必须开发使用数据库的标准和过程.研究表明,相比标准化较低的公司,那些高标准化的公司可以将用于支持终端用户的成本降低35%甚至更多.必须开发使用数据库的标准和过程.标准是用于确保数据库环境的一致性和有效性的常见做法,如数据库命名约定.程序是定义好的.步进式的指示,用于指导处理具体事件的事务,如灾难恢复计划.未能实现数据库标准和过程会使数据库环境变得混乱且难以管理.DBA应当开发数据库标准和过程,以此作为企业范围内IT标准和过程的组成部分.它们

js 轮播-一个js轮播器,可以用用但是性能差

问题描述 一个js轮播器,可以用用但是性能差 html------------------------ <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> <link rel="stylesheet" href="style/main.cs

NAS特定场景下buffered io比direct io读性能差问题的调查

最近一位NAS用户在微信上报道了NAS的性能测试报告,报告中测试数据显示buffered io读性能比direct io读要差.这显然和直观的认识不符,在内存充足的情况下,buffered io读的数据一般都在page cache中,每次读都是内存操作,其性能应该远远高于direct io,但测试数据却得到了相反的结果,这说明某些地方拖慢了buffered io读性能. 首先回顾一下用户的测试场景:保证内存完全够用的情况下,使用fio工具,基于libaio对比测试buffered io和dire

云计算建立首个数据库标准 CMDBf使云可预测

本文讲的是云计算建立首个数据库标准 CMDBf使云可预测,[IT168 资讯]日前,非营利性机构分布式管理任务组(DMTF)的多家企业联合宣布,推出一项新的云计算开放标准,命名为CMDB联盟标准,也称CMDBf标准. CMDB(Configuration Management Database,配置管理数据库)是IT运维系统中的一个基础数据平台,可以让IT机构对其企业计算环境中的各项组件的属性.关系和依赖性做到完全可视.新的CMDB联盟标准提供了从分布在多个数据仓库中的CMDB数据库获取IT信息